What is Dimethyl Fumarate used for?

Arbicen is primarily used to help manage certain immune-related conditions. It works by modulating the immune system's response, which can help reduce inflammation and other symptoms. People often ask, 'What is Arbicen used for?' It is commonly prescribed for conditions that involve an overactive immune response.

What are the side effects of Dimethyl Fumarate?

Common effects of Arbicen may include gastrointestinal discomfort, flushing, and mild headaches. These effects are usually temporary and may vary from person to person. It's important to note that individual experiences can differ, and not everyone will experience the same effects.
